Autumn Rowe (born May 25, 1981) is an American singer-songwriter, TV personality, DJ and activist from South Bronx, New York, United States.
[1] In 2015, Rowe signed an artist deal with Ultra Records,[2] and in 2018 she began performing publicly as the DJ AFTR PRTY.
[3] In early 2020, she wrote and performed vocals on the drum and bass song "Good To Me", by British DJ Friction.
[4] In 2020, Rowe began to use her platform for activism and co-wrote the song "We Are" with Jon Batiste, which was used on the "Mask Up America" campaign.
[6] Rowe's first co-writing credit came when she signed a development deal with producer Swizz Beats who played one of her original songs to British soul artist Estelle.
Estelle decided to rewrite parts of the song for her own project, keeping Rowe's chorus and writing new verses around it.
Rowe also collaborated with British artist Cher Lloyd on the multi-platinum single "Swagger Jagger".
Continuing her collaborations with America's Got Talent contestant Grace Vaderwaal, Rowe co-wrote her singles "Gossip Girl", "Light the Sky", and "Clay".
